Guilins
01/13/2025, 8:47 PMMarvin
01/13/2025, 8:47 PMprefect.yaml
file, you can specify a schedules
section. Here's an example of how you might set it up:
yaml
name: my_flow
description: A simple flow with a schedule
version: 1.0
schedules:
- type: Interval
interval: 600 # seconds
start_date: "2026-01-01T00:00:00Z"
timezone: "America/Chicago"
active: true
In this example, the schedule is set to run the flow every 10 minutes, starting at midnight on January 1, 2026, in the America/Chicago timezone. You can choose from different schedule types like Cron
, Interval
, and RRule
depending on your needs.
For more details on creating schedules and other configurations, you can refer to the Prefect documentation on adding schedules.Guilins
01/13/2025, 9:01 PMMarvin
01/13/2025, 9:01 PMCron
schedule instead of an Interval
schedule in your prefect.yaml
file:
yaml
name: my_flow
description: A simple flow with a cron schedule
version: 1.0
schedules:
- type: Cron
cron: "0 * * * *" # Every hour on the hour
timezone: "America/Chicago"
active: true
In this example, the flow is scheduled to run every hour on the hour using a cron expression. You can adjust the cron expression to fit your specific scheduling needs. For more details, you can refer to the Prefect documentation on adding schedules.Bring your towel and join one of the fastest growing data communities. Welcome to our second-generation open source orchestration platform, a completely rethought approach to dataflow automation.
Powered by